diff options
author | Adam NAILI | 2018-01-10 21:07:57 +0100 |
---|---|---|
committer | Adam NAILI | 2018-01-10 21:07:57 +0100 |
commit | 2f13788663e9384bb175ef688408de16cbc7918b (patch) | |
tree | 57005d72cb300e327ad11205a7d488b03ff060ff /src/main/java | |
parent | 474444d4fad7c6c86ae01a2c208d330840283665 (diff) | |
download | wallj-2f13788663e9384bb175ef688408de16cbc7918b.tar.gz |
Updating javadoc and placing @author
Diffstat (limited to 'src/main/java')
12 files changed, 50 insertions, 0 deletions
diff --git a/src/main/java/fr/umlv/java/wallj/context/Context.java b/src/main/java/fr/umlv/java/wallj/context/Context.java index de9c461..053bc8e 100644 --- a/src/main/java/fr/umlv/java/wallj/context/Context.java +++ b/src/main/java/fr/umlv/java/wallj/context/Context.java | |||
@@ -8,6 +8,8 @@ import java.util.Objects; | |||
8 | 8 | ||
9 | /** | 9 | /** |
10 | * A context used to store the current state of the application at one tick | 10 | * A context used to store the current state of the application at one tick |
11 | * | ||
12 | * @author Adam NAILI | ||
11 | */ | 13 | */ |
12 | public final class Context { | 14 | public final class Context { |
13 | //TODO Class Context | 15 | //TODO Class Context |
diff --git a/src/main/java/fr/umlv/java/wallj/context/Game.java b/src/main/java/fr/umlv/java/wallj/context/Game.java index 53f61b4..7ddac02 100644 --- a/src/main/java/fr/umlv/java/wallj/context/Game.java +++ b/src/main/java/fr/umlv/java/wallj/context/Game.java | |||
@@ -10,6 +10,7 @@ import java.util.Objects; | |||
10 | 10 | ||
11 | /** | 11 | /** |
12 | * A game. | 12 | * A game. |
13 | * @author Adam NAILI | ||
13 | */ | 14 | */ |
14 | public final class Game { | 15 | public final class Game { |
15 | //TODO | 16 | //TODO |
diff --git a/src/main/java/fr/umlv/java/wallj/context/GraphicsContext.java b/src/main/java/fr/umlv/java/wallj/context/GraphicsContext.java index 9d5ec0d..1fb07de 100644 --- a/src/main/java/fr/umlv/java/wallj/context/GraphicsContext.java +++ b/src/main/java/fr/umlv/java/wallj/context/GraphicsContext.java | |||
@@ -10,6 +10,8 @@ import java.util.Objects; | |||
10 | 10 | ||
11 | /** | 11 | /** |
12 | * A context of the current graphic status of the application. | 12 | * A context of the current graphic status of the application. |
13 | * | ||
14 | * @author Adam NAILI | ||
13 | */ | 15 | */ |
14 | public final class GraphicsContext { | 16 | public final class GraphicsContext { |
15 | //TODO Class GraphicsContext | 17 | //TODO Class GraphicsContext |
diff --git a/src/main/java/fr/umlv/java/wallj/context/InputHandler.java b/src/main/java/fr/umlv/java/wallj/context/InputHandler.java index e3546fa..637e94f 100644 --- a/src/main/java/fr/umlv/java/wallj/context/InputHandler.java +++ b/src/main/java/fr/umlv/java/wallj/context/InputHandler.java | |||
@@ -16,6 +16,8 @@ import java.util.Objects; | |||
16 | 16 | ||
17 | /** | 17 | /** |
18 | * Treats the inputs from the keyboard and mouse provided by Zen 5 and creates Events meaningful for the game. | 18 | * Treats the inputs from the keyboard and mouse provided by Zen 5 and creates Events meaningful for the game. |
19 | * | ||
20 | * @author Adam NAILI | ||
19 | */ | 21 | */ |
20 | public final class InputHandler { | 22 | public final class InputHandler { |
21 | //TODO Class InputHandler | 23 | //TODO Class InputHandler |
diff --git a/src/main/java/fr/umlv/java/wallj/context/ScreenManager.java b/src/main/java/fr/umlv/java/wallj/context/ScreenManager.java index d687246..2f28ac9 100644 --- a/src/main/java/fr/umlv/java/wallj/context/ScreenManager.java +++ b/src/main/java/fr/umlv/java/wallj/context/ScreenManager.java | |||
@@ -9,6 +9,8 @@ import java.util.Objects; | |||
9 | 9 | ||
10 | /** | 10 | /** |
11 | * Cleans the GraphicsContext | 11 | * Cleans the GraphicsContext |
12 | * | ||
13 | * @author Adam NAILI | ||
12 | */ | 14 | */ |
13 | public final class ScreenManager { | 15 | public final class ScreenManager { |
14 | //TODO Class ScreenManager | 16 | //TODO Class ScreenManager |
diff --git a/src/main/java/fr/umlv/java/wallj/event/AddBombEvent.java b/src/main/java/fr/umlv/java/wallj/event/AddBombEvent.java index eef0329..10581ff 100644 --- a/src/main/java/fr/umlv/java/wallj/event/AddBombEvent.java +++ b/src/main/java/fr/umlv/java/wallj/event/AddBombEvent.java | |||
@@ -4,9 +4,17 @@ import fr.umlv.java.wallj.board.TileVec2; | |||
4 | 4 | ||
5 | import java.util.Objects; | 5 | import java.util.Objects; |
6 | 6 | ||
7 | /** | ||
8 | * Event to put a bomb on the game board | ||
9 | * | ||
10 | * @author Adam NAILI | ||
11 | */ | ||
7 | public final class AddBombEvent implements InputEvent { | 12 | public final class AddBombEvent implements InputEvent { |
8 | TileVec2 tileVec2; | 13 | TileVec2 tileVec2; |
9 | 14 | ||
15 | /** | ||
16 | * @param tileVec2 a vector with coordinate relative to the tile | ||
17 | */ | ||
10 | public AddBombEvent(TileVec2 tileVec2) { | 18 | public AddBombEvent(TileVec2 tileVec2) { |
11 | this.tileVec2 = Objects.requireNonNull(tileVec2); | 19 | this.tileVec2 = Objects.requireNonNull(tileVec2); |
12 | } | 20 | } |
diff --git a/src/main/java/fr/umlv/java/wallj/event/ConfirmEvent.java b/src/main/java/fr/umlv/java/wallj/event/ConfirmEvent.java index 16b0d8b..6f1e403 100644 --- a/src/main/java/fr/umlv/java/wallj/event/ConfirmEvent.java +++ b/src/main/java/fr/umlv/java/wallj/event/ConfirmEvent.java | |||
@@ -1,5 +1,10 @@ | |||
1 | package fr.umlv.java.wallj.event; | 1 | package fr.umlv.java.wallj.event; |
2 | 2 | ||
3 | /** | ||
4 | * Event coming from a confirmation action from the user | ||
5 | * | ||
6 | * @author Adam NAILI | ||
7 | */ | ||
3 | public class ConfirmEvent implements InputEvent { | 8 | public class ConfirmEvent implements InputEvent { |
4 | //TODO Class ConfirmEvent | 9 | //TODO Class ConfirmEvent |
5 | } | 10 | } |
diff --git a/src/main/java/fr/umlv/java/wallj/event/DropBombEvent.java b/src/main/java/fr/umlv/java/wallj/event/DropBombEvent.java index d0ac956..4386288 100644 --- a/src/main/java/fr/umlv/java/wallj/event/DropBombEvent.java +++ b/src/main/java/fr/umlv/java/wallj/event/DropBombEvent.java | |||
@@ -1,5 +1,10 @@ | |||
1 | package fr.umlv.java.wallj.event; | 1 | package fr.umlv.java.wallj.event; |
2 | 2 | ||
3 | /** | ||
4 | * Event to signal that a bomb will be placed at the next tick | ||
5 | * | ||
6 | * @author Adam NAILI | ||
7 | */ | ||
3 | public final class DropBombEvent implements InputEvent { | 8 | public final class DropBombEvent implements InputEvent { |
4 | //TODO Class DropBombEvent | 9 | //TODO Class DropBombEvent |
5 | } | 10 | } |
diff --git a/src/main/java/fr/umlv/java/wallj/event/Event.java b/src/main/java/fr/umlv/java/wallj/event/Event.java index 034e345..77ce0df 100644 --- a/src/main/java/fr/umlv/java/wallj/event/Event.java +++ b/src/main/java/fr/umlv/java/wallj/event/Event.java | |||
@@ -1,4 +1,9 @@ | |||
1 | package fr.umlv.java.wallj.event; | 1 | package fr.umlv.java.wallj.event; |
2 | 2 | ||
3 | /** | ||
4 | * An application event | ||
5 | * | ||
6 | * @author Adam NAILI | ||
7 | */ | ||
3 | public interface Event { | 8 | public interface Event { |
4 | } | 9 | } |
diff --git a/src/main/java/fr/umlv/java/wallj/event/GameEvent.java b/src/main/java/fr/umlv/java/wallj/event/GameEvent.java index 53381a7..2fe1281 100644 --- a/src/main/java/fr/umlv/java/wallj/event/GameEvent.java +++ b/src/main/java/fr/umlv/java/wallj/event/GameEvent.java | |||
@@ -1,5 +1,10 @@ | |||
1 | package fr.umlv.java.wallj.event; | 1 | package fr.umlv.java.wallj.event; |
2 | 2 | ||
3 | /** | ||
4 | * A game event | ||
5 | * | ||
6 | * @author Adam NAILI | ||
7 | */ | ||
3 | public interface GameEvent extends Event{ | 8 | public interface GameEvent extends Event{ |
4 | 9 | ||
5 | } | 10 | } |
diff --git a/src/main/java/fr/umlv/java/wallj/event/InputEvent.java b/src/main/java/fr/umlv/java/wallj/event/InputEvent.java index 3452c66..d18cba0 100644 --- a/src/main/java/fr/umlv/java/wallj/event/InputEvent.java +++ b/src/main/java/fr/umlv/java/wallj/event/InputEvent.java | |||
@@ -1,5 +1,10 @@ | |||
1 | package fr.umlv.java.wallj.event; | 1 | package fr.umlv.java.wallj.event; |
2 | 2 | ||
3 | /** | ||
4 | * An event coming from inputs | ||
5 | * | ||
6 | * @author Adam NAILI | ||
7 | */ | ||
3 | public interface InputEvent extends Event { | 8 | public interface InputEvent extends Event { |
4 | 9 | ||
5 | } | 10 | } |
diff --git a/src/main/java/fr/umlv/java/wallj/event/MoveRobotEvent.java b/src/main/java/fr/umlv/java/wallj/event/MoveRobotEvent.java index 7b3e115..a8c9da2 100644 --- a/src/main/java/fr/umlv/java/wallj/event/MoveRobotEvent.java +++ b/src/main/java/fr/umlv/java/wallj/event/MoveRobotEvent.java | |||
@@ -4,10 +4,18 @@ import fr.umlv.java.wallj.board.TileVec2; | |||
4 | 4 | ||
5 | import java.util.Objects; | 5 | import java.util.Objects; |
6 | 6 | ||
7 | /** | ||
8 | * Event to precise that the robot is supposed to move on the tile provided | ||
9 | * | ||
10 | * @author Adam NAILI | ||
11 | */ | ||
7 | public class MoveRobotEvent implements InputEvent { | 12 | public class MoveRobotEvent implements InputEvent { |
8 | //TODO Class MoveRobotEvent | 13 | //TODO Class MoveRobotEvent |
9 | TileVec2 tileVec2; | 14 | TileVec2 tileVec2; |
10 | 15 | ||
16 | /** | ||
17 | * @param tileVec2 the target tile | ||
18 | */ | ||
11 | public MoveRobotEvent(TileVec2 tileVec2) { | 19 | public MoveRobotEvent(TileVec2 tileVec2) { |
12 | this.tileVec2 = Objects.requireNonNull(tileVec2); | 20 | this.tileVec2 = Objects.requireNonNull(tileVec2); |
13 | } | 21 | } |